Good Tuesday evening. We have a quick hitting wet snow heading into the area overnight into Wednesday. This system will be fighting temps just above freezing and a mild ground. But, it should still be able to put down some slushy accumulation.

Here is something that’s been a rarity this winter,a first call for snowfall map…

Much of what falls will be melting on contact… especially across the south. Elevated and grassy surfaces will be the main areas to see some accumulating snow. I’m not expecting a whole lot in the way of slick travel, but it may come down hard enough to cause a quick slick spot.

Light snow will taper off from west to east Wednesday afternoon into the evening.

This isn’t a one and done snow chance. I like the Friday night into Saturday morning chance for snow along and behind an arctic front. This will usher in some very cold air for the weekend and some temps may not make it out of the 20s for highs.
